T has been talking quite a bit these days. He really cracks me up because when he talks, he speaks in whatever language that comes to his mind.

Yesterday, he broke his Anpanman sponge in the bathtub. It's a round-faced character and he tore off a bit at its right ear. So these are what he said to me, in this order, in this particular fashion.

"Oh oh, Ear nai(not here)"
"Broke it."
"Itai (ouch)"
"mimi(ear) gone"
"what did you do?"
"nani-hoshii (what do you want?!)"

He is just stringing words together in the way it makes sense to him and he really has no clue he is speaking Japanese or English right now. Currently he communicates best with people who are bilingual *lol*
